Output efcd8abdac98cfafd7b6c37c8aec9efa526e4e91bb1d75dafa7afb06489404e6:20

value
983362
script pubkey
OP_0 OP_PUSHBYTES_20 51ba3831d69d426011b8ae2fca5e51921367eaca
address
bc1q2xarsvwkn4pxqydc4chu5hj3jgfk06k223sl4z
transaction
efcd8abdac98cfafd7b6c37c8aec9efa526e4e91bb1d75dafa7afb06489404e6
spent
true